Extracapsular cataract extraction with lens implant under local anaesthesia consisting of amethocaine drops followed by a simple subconjunctival injection in the upper part of the globe but without a retrobulbar injection was carried out in 175 eyes of 165 patients. CASE 1 A 69-year-old male general maintenance labourer attended eye casualty with a history of blurred vision in his left eye. He had been using an electrically driven wire brush at work when a fragment of wire broke off the brush hitting his eye.
